About Marisela

Inspiration

The inspiration for my paintings is the essential vitality of nature, through color I touch the vibrancy of existence, the dance of form animated with breath and motion. I aim to express the energy, the potency and emotion evoked by the gestures of nature, the drama, the joy, the subtleness or boldness as it manifests in each element, be it solid or ethereal, be it creature or plant. In my paintings sometimes the strokes decompose into abstraction, others they manifest as recognizable form. At times the paintings aim to reconstruct creation itself, others they travel through possible landscapes as they settle out of chaos into particular expressions and qualities of being. 

Background

I was born in Mexico City, Mexico is a country fond of cultural and artistic expression, since I was a child the arts were a central part of my life. The entertainment my mother provided for us consisted of attending live symphony, theater and dance performances and visiting art museums. Since early age I found specially compelling, the power visual arts have to convey with a single “impression” a mood as profound and mysterious as our own physique. With this early exposure to creative expression, the imprint that Mexican art left in me, is very deep.

Career

I began my artistic and graphic design career in Mexico City. The journey of life brought me to the US and finally to Hawaii, where I’ve lived for almost 30 years. I studied fine arts at the Autonomous University of Mexico, at the NW College of Art, and received a MFA Degree from the University of Colorado at Boulder. I’ve had solo exhibitions in Mexico City; Portland, Oregon; Boulder, Colorado and Maui, Hawaii. Technique

My paintings thrive with technical and thematic experimentation. Presently I am focused on acrylics and watercolors, sometimes working with transparent layers of color with the help of mediums and resin, others building three dimensional relief and textural surfaces.
I started my fine arts and graphic designer career simultaneously, and since the beginning of the digital era, I developed wonderful digital imaging skills. I was called to explore the infinitely creative digital universe and produced a body of work consisting of digital paintings blending my photography, drawings and watercolors. 
My poetry book: Water Kiss is fully illustrated with digital collages where some of the images are further developed to be displayed as pieces of art.
